Google Nexus One has just got one more reason to make users wag their tongues. Nexus One phone has recently received an all-new over-the-air software update. The new update comes with some great new features, and fixes a few problems.

Google Goggles mobile application will now be available directly on users’ phone by launching it from their All Apps menu. Users can now use their Nexus One camera to start searching the web.

Quite impressively, Google Maps application will be updated to a new version, Google Maps 3.4. This particular update will come equipped with starred items synchronized with maps.google.com enabling users to access their favorite places from the phone or computer. Google Maps 3.4 version will also make it easy for users to search for places they have searched before.

In addition, Google Maps new version will automatically change one’s screen at night for easier viewing and driving. Well, the latest Nexus update now offers an unrivaled pinch-to-zoom functionality, where the handset includes a new pinch-to-zoom mechanism in the phone’s Browser, Gallery and Maps applications.

Further, the update comes with a general fix to help improve 3G connectivity on some Nexus One phones.

Users will receive a message on their phone’s notification bar. Just download the update, wait for it to install, and gird up to experience these latest improvements.
